The Provincial Court of Alicante has upheld an appeal filed by criminal defense attorney Agustín Brandi and acquitted a 25-year-old man who had previously been sentenced to three years in prison for aggravated assault in a case related to gender-based violence.
The ruling completely overturns the judgment issued by Criminal Court No. 2 of Alicante, which had found the defendant responsible for an alleged assault that took place in August 2025 at the home he shared with his partner.
After reviewing the appeal, the Provincial Court concluded that the evidence presented was insufficient to prove the defendant's responsibility beyond reasonable doubt. As a result, the court ordered his acquittal and set aside the conviction imposed at first instance.
